As of 2026-04-18, Nuveen S&P 500 Buy-Write Income Fund Common Shares of Beneficial Interest (BXMX) trades at a current price of $13.26, marking a 2.07% decline in recent trading sessions. This closed-end fund employs a covered call, or buy-write, strategy tied to the S&P 500 index, seeking to generate regular income for shareholders alongside exposure to large-cap U.S. equities.
